[JS IR] Fix IC invalidation process when symbols are modified
The patch fixes the cases of IC invalidation when symbols are modified: adding and removing inline, data, in, out, suspend qualifiers. For that purpose an extra hash is used. It is written in a direct dependency graph into an IC cache metadata file. For inline functions a transitive hash is used. For non-inline functions, classes, and others a symbol hash is used. The invalidation routine marks the file as dirty (with 'updated imports' state) if hash is modified. ^KT-51083 Fixed ^KT-51088 Fixed ^KT-51090 Fixed ^KT-51099 Fixed
